ABSTRACT
The Indian Railways has one of the largest railway networks in the world, crises- crossing over 1,15,000 km in
distance, all over India. However, with regard to reliability and passenger safety Indian Railways is not up to
global standards. Among other factors, cracks developed on the rails due to absence of timely detection and the
associated maintenance pose serious questions on the security of operation of rail transport. A recent study
revealed that over 25% of the track length is in need of replacement due to the development of cracks on it.
Manual detection of tracks is cumbersome and not fully effective owing to much time consumption and
requirement of skilled technicians. This project work is aimed towards addressing the issue by developing an
automatic railway track crack detection system.
This work introduces a project that aims in designing robust railway crack detection scheme (RCODS) using IR
SENSOR assembly system which avoids the train accidents by detecting the cracks on railway tracks. And also
capable of alerting the authorities in the form of SMS messages along with location by using GPS and WiFi
modules. The system also includes distance measuring sensor which displays the track deviation distance
between the railway tracks.

III. HARDWARE WORKING
In our project, there are two set of IR sensor units fitted to the two sides of the vehicle. This unit is used to
activate/deactivate Node MCU transmitter unit when there is any cracks in the track. The IR transmitter and IR
receiver circuit is used to sense the cracks. It is fixed to the front sides of the vehicle with a suitable
arrangement. When the vehicle is Powered On, it moves along the model track. The IR sensors monitor the
condition of the tracks. In normal condition the motor, LDR, Serial transmission is in initial stage. When the
battery power supply supplies the microcontroller then its starting the motor in forward direction and serial
transmission is used to send the messages to the microcontroller. When a crack is detected by the IR sensor the
vehicle stops at once, and the GPS receiver triangulates the position of the vehicle to receive the Latitude and
Longitude coordinates of the vehicle position, from satellites. The Latitude and Longitude coordinates received
by GPS are converted into a text message which is done by microcontroller. The Wifi module sends the text
message to the predefined number with the help of SIM card that isinserted into the module.
At Normal Condition:
The IR transmitter sensor is transmitting the infrared rays. These infrared rays are received by the IR receiver
sensor. The Transistors are used as an amplifier section. At normal condition Transistor is OFF condition. At
that time relay is OFF, so that the vehicle running continuously.
At Crack Condition:
At crack detection conditions the IR transmitter and IR receiver, the resistance across the Transmitter and
receiver is high due to the non-conductivity of the IR waves. When the track is in continuous without any cracks
then output of IR LED and Photodiode will be high. As soon as the crack detected by the system the IR sensor
reflection will be equal to zero and the robot will be stopped automatically. Another IR sensor is used to
monitor the pit on the way of the railway track. When this output is high then it is concluded that there is no pit
in the track. But if any pit is detected by the sensor the output of the sensor given to the microcontroller will be
zero and again the microcontroller will stop the robot. When a crack is detected by the IR sensor the vehicle
stops at once, and the GPS receiver triangulates the position of the vehicle to receive the Latitude and Longitude
coordinates of the vehicle position, from satellites. The Latitude and Longitude coordinates received by GPS are
converted into a text message which is done by microcontroller. The Wifi module sends the text message to the
